  4. Sep 8, 2021 · Rice University’s class of 2025 acceptance rate was 9.3%, with just 2,346 students being accepted from a pool of 29,53 applicants—up from 23,443 applicants the year before. Like most schools, Rice’s 19.78% early decision (ED) acceptance rate was significantly higher than its regular decision rate.

  7. Apr 20, 2020 · Rice University is a private research university with an acceptance rate of 8.7%. Located in Houston, Texas, the university boasts a multi-billion-dollar endowment, a 6-to-1 student/faculty ratio, a median class size of 15, and a residential college system. In athletics, the Rice Owls compete in the NCAA Division I Conference USA (C-USA).

  8. Mar 30, 2021 · Rice received a record number of applications for the coming academic year, as just over 29,500 students applied for a spot in the 2021 freshman class. That represents a 26% increase over the previous year, an expansion that was spread broadly across the applicant pool regardless of geography, academic interest, gender, race or ethnicity.
